Bibliographic description
2v. 8vo. Provenance: Nineteenth-century armorial bookplate: 'John Gardner Wilkinson Brynfield House.' [i.e. Sir John Gardner Wilkinson (1795-1875)]. . Provenance: Signature on flyleaves: 'C. Bayley 1795 / Trin: Coll: Cant:' [probably Cornelius Bayley (1751-1812)]. Binding: Eighteenth-century full blotched calf. Spines gilt, with crest of deer's head on black label at head of vol. 1. All title-labels lacking.
